WTG is rapidly expanding its unique co-managed technology services offering, WTG NorthstarMS. As a Managed Services Engineer (MSE), you’ll be an integral part of our Northstar Managed Services team, collaborating closely with other engineers, the Managed Service Manager, and company SMEs. You’ll implement agreed-upon services for our client base in a fast-paced, dynamic environment, gaining exposure to diverse systems and delivery methodologies. This role offers invaluable opportunities to learn from seasoned IT professionals and refine your technical skills. With solid knowledge in technical operations, you’ll manage ticket queues against quality standards, proactively communicate status updates to clients, and escalate issues within the team as needed. At WTG, we hold customer success as the cornerstone of successful managed services, and you’ll have the opportunity to deeply understand this philosophy and put it into practice every day.
